Урок-обобщение в 7 классе по теме «О вкусной и здоровой пище»

Учитель английского языка МАОУ СОШ №43 города Томска

Татьяна Викторовна Бондаренко

Цели урока

  1. Практические: обобщить и систематизировать знания и умения учащихся по теме "Healthy Living Guide" (конкретно по разделу "О вкусной и здоровой пище"About Tasty and Healthy Food").
  2. Образовательные: знакомить учащихся с различными пословицами и поговорками, сравнить их с русскими эквивалентами; знакомить с национальной кухней России и Британии; приобретение знаний о группах пищи, содержащей различные вещества, необходи мые для жизнедеятельности человека.
  3. Развивающие: развивать воображение, фантазию, творческое мышление; развивать речевые способности, способности логически излагать; развивать умение сравнивать, ана лизировать.
  4. Воспитательные: Учить учащихся бережно относиться к своему здоровью; правильно питаться.

Оборудование. Таблицы, выставка творческих работ учащихся, альбомы "Sandwich", "Food Diary", которые они готовят заранее.

  1.  “Balanced Diet”

T. First of all tell me, please, what is important in order to stay healthy?

P. In order to stay healthy it is important to have a balanced diet.

T. What does it mean?

P. It means that food should contain something from each of the three main groups of food.

T. What are these groups?

P. These are protein, fat and carbohydrates.

T. What can you tell about each of these groups?

P. We find protein in lots of food, for example, meat, fish, nuts, cheese. It helps our body grow and it gives us energy.

T. What about fat?

P. Fat gives us energy but we shouldn`t eat a lot - it's bad for us. There are a lot of fatty foods that come from animals, for example, milk, cheese, butter, some kinds of meat.

T. And what about carbohydrates?

P. Carbohydrates give us more than 70% of our energy. Bread, pastes, fruits, vegetables such as potatoes and cabbage all contain lots of carbohydrates.

T. What else is important for our body?

P. Our body needs many different vitamins. They help our body to be healthy. We can get them from fruit and vegetables.

6. “British Cuisine”

T. And what about British cuisine? On what occasions do British people eat these dishes?

P.

1) A shortbread is a hard sweet biscuit made with a lot of butter.

  1.  A haggis is a food eaten in Scotland made from the heart and other organs of a sheep cut up and boiled inside a skin, made from the sheep's stomach. A haggis is typically eaten with boiled turnips and potatoes. Scottish  people  eat a haggis on January 25th, the birthday of Robert Burns, Scotland's national poet.
  2.  A burger is a round flat cake of meat or other things, often contained in a bread roll. There are cheese- burger, ham-burger, fish-burger.
  3.  In Britain many people make pancakes on Shrove Tuesday, so it is called Pancake Day.
  4.  On Christmas Day British people eat roast turkey, roasted potatoes, Christmas pudding.
  5.  A hot-cross bun is a small sweet cake made of bread with a cross-shaped mark on top, which is eaten on Good Friday, just before Easter.
  6.  On November 5th British people celebrate Guy Fawkes Night, they light fireworks, burn a guy on a bonfire and cook toffee apples
  7.  On Easter Sunday the British eat chocolate eggs, boiled eggs, cake.

9) Roast meat has always been the Englishman's first choice. Sunday lunch must be some roast beef it's almost an English law. It is still number one today, according to surveys.

  1.  The British calf beef, mutton, crab, plaice and sole accompanied by incredible amounts of bread, salads and greens "simple food". It was and often still is the British style of eating.
  2.  There is a joke instead of central heating the British have puddings. They have sweet puddings and chocolate puddings, cabinet puddings with treacle and puddings with marmalade. They have stout white puddings crammed with currants raisins and other fruit. British puddings are eaten to keep out the cold, and at Christmas the great king of puddings comes flaming and splendid.
  3.  I want to add that pies are another British favorite not only fruit pies, but steak -kidney pies, made ideally with flaky paste, crisp and buttery and golden brown.
  4.  It is interesting to know that the Great Fire of London in 1666 broke out in Puddings Lane, but the statue that celebrates its end is on Pie Corner!

7. “The Dish That Has a Long History”

T. Well. Do you know any dish that has a long history?

P. Yes, I do. Ice cream has a long history. The first "ice cream" appeared 3000 years ago in China. The ancient Chinese ate snow mixed with rice and fruit. The ancient Romans ate milk mixed with ice and fruit Emperor Nero sent his slaves into the mountains where they got some snow and then mixed it with honey. In the 13th century Marco Polo, an Italian traveler, visited China and spent 17 years there. When he came back to Italy he taught his friends how to make ice cream. In 1672 the first ice cream cafe was opened in Paris. In the 19th century the fridge was invented and people learned how to make ice. Waffle cups were invented in 1903. Today, there are all kinds of ice cream, in Japan you can even buy octopus and shrimp ice cream. And ice cream can be of many colors, even black!
